Important Safety and Product Information

Warnings
Failure to avoid the following potentially hazardous
situations could result in an accident or collision
resulting in death or serious injury.
When installing the unit in a vehicle, place the
unit securely so it does not obstruct the driver's
view of the road or interfere with vehicle operating
controls, such as the steering wheel, foot pedals, or
transmission levers. Do not place in front of or above
any airbag. (See diagram.)

When navigating, carefully compare information
displayed on the unit to all available navigation
sources, including information from street signs,
visual sightings, and maps. For safety, always resolve
any discrepancies or questions before continuing
navigation and defer to posted road signs.
Always operate the vehicle in a safe manner. Do not
become distracted by the unit while driving, and
always be fully aware of all driving conditions.

Minimize the amount of time spent viewing the
unit's screen while driving and use voice prompts
when possible. Do not input destinations, change
settings, or access any functions requiring prolonged
use of the unit's controls while driving. Pull over
in a safe and legal manner before attempting such
operations.
